Body Composition Analyzers Market: Advancing Precision in Health and Fitness Assessment
The Body Composition Analyzers Market is gaining significant traction as global interest in preventive health, personalized fitness, and chronic disease management increases. Unlike conventional weight scales, body composition analyzers offer in-depth insights into body fat percentage, muscle mass, bone density, hydration levels, and more—making them indispensable tools in clinical, sports, and wellness environments.
Driven by technological innovation, expanding healthcare applications, and rising health consciousness, the market is evolving rapidly, opening new opportunities for manufacturers, healthcare providers, and digital wellness platforms.

Key Market Drivers
Rising Obesity and Metabolic Disorders
The global obesity epidemic is pushing healthcare providers to adopt tools that provide more precise health metrics beyond BMI, such as fat-to-muscle ratio and visceral fat levels.Increased Demand from Fitness and Wellness Sectors
Gyms, personal trainers, and wellness centers are integrating body composition analyzers to provide personalized fitness plans and progress tracking, contributing to higher product adoption.Technological Innovations
Advanced analyzers now include multi-frequency BIA (bioelectrical impedance analysis), DEXA (dual-energy X-ray absorptiometry), ultrasound, and 3D body scanning, making assessments more accurate and comprehensive.Clinical Use in Disease Management
Body composition data is being increasingly used in managing conditions like sarcopenia, cancer cachexia, eating disorders, and post-surgical recovery—offering critical support for therapeutic decisions.

Regional Insights
North America dominates the market due to high fitness tech penetration, awareness campaigns on obesity, and advanced diagnostic infrastructure.
Europe follows with strong demand from wellness tourism, public health initiatives, and elite sports programs.
Asia-Pacific is the fastest-growing region, fueled by urbanization, rising fitness awareness, and expanding middle-class healthcare spending.
Key Players and Trends
Major companies in the market include InBody Co., Ltd., Tanita Corporation, SECA GmbH, GE Healthcare, Omron Corporation, and Hologic, Inc. Recent trends include integration with mobile apps, cloud-based data tracking, and remote health monitoring solutions.
